hydrodynamics
This term describes the technical study of fluid motion, specifically focusing on the interaction between liquids and solid surfaces. It carries a highly academic and professional connotation, typically appearing in textbooks, engineering reports, and scientific journals rather than in casual conversation.
Despite ending in s, the word functions as a singular mass noun referring to a field of study. It follows the pattern of other academic disciplines like physics or mathematics, meaning it takes a singular verb and cannot be pluralized to describe multiple instances of the science.
